We Go at Your Pace
I always make sure we have time to have a chat before I even pick up my camera. I never like to rush, so you can be sure there is plenty of time for everyone to settle in. I also want to let you in on a little secret: If things go completely pear-shaped on the day, we can always try again on a different day. I want you to come to your session feeling happy and excited, not stressed and worried that something might go wrong.
My studio is a no-pressure zone. This is so important for:
- Shy Toddlers: They often need a few minutes to realise the studio is a fun place to be.
- New Mums: Who might need a moment to catch their breath (and maybe have a quick cuddle or a feed with the baby).
- Nervous Parents: Who worry their kids won't behave. Please don't worry, I love the wild and silly moments! Some of the very best photos are the spontaneous ones that happen when you’re just being yourselves.
You Have My Full Attention
I don’t book standard studio sessions back-to-back because you deserve my full focus. I limit my sessions to a maximum of two a day (or just one for newborns). This means that if we need to pause for a snack or a break, we do it! I want you to leave my studio thinking, "That was actually really fun," rather than feeling stressed.
